    Description: Apex core has streaming windows that establish a boundary 
based on arrival time of events. Many applications require boundaries based on 
the time of events, which could be a field in the tuple. Some of the operators 
support this today (time bucketing), but it would be good to provide more 
generic support for this in the engine itself.
